Porch Rail Repair in Olathe, KS
Porch rail repair services focus on restoring the safety, stability, and appearance of existing porch railings.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ing damaged balusters, handrails, posts, or brackets to ensure they meet safety standards and complement the property's aesthetic. Homeowners often seek these services when railings become loose, cracked, rotted, or otherwise compromised due to weather exposure or age, aiming to maintain a secure and attractive outdoor space.
Before requesting porch rail rep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work needed, including the extent of damage and the materials involved. It’s common to inquire about the durability of replacement parts, the compatibility with existing structures, and any necessary adjustments to meet safety or building codes. Clarifying these details helps ensure the repair work aligns with property maintenance goals and preserves the integrity of the porch area.

Porch Rail Repair Questions
What types of porch rail damage can be repaired? Common issues include rotted wood, loose or broken balusters, and damaged handrails that compromise safety and appearance.
Is porch rail repair suitable for all materials? Yes, repairs can be performed on wood, vinyl, metal, and composite railings to restore stability and aesthetics.
When should porch rails be repaired instead of replaced? Repairs are appropriate when damage is localized, such as minor rot or loose components, rather than extensive structural issues.
What are typical signs that porch rails need repair? Visible cracks, wobbling, missing parts, or signs of rot indicate that repair or maintenance may be needed.
